                        It's not real....... being modern machine stitched. Back is pressed glued and not at all consistent with originals. Had the back been removed it might have needed a second look. But as John said.......the stitching is tightly pulled to the edges as a machine would have stitched it. The eyebrow, when present is usually a seprate stitch Good fake, but still a fake IMO.
